“NO RISK” ARTS WORKSHOP FUNDING AVAILABLE

The Region 2 Arts Council invites individuals and organizations from our five-county area (Beltrami, Clearwater, Hubbard, Lake of the Woods and Mahnomen Counties) to propose workshop ideas to R2AC for direct funding. Region 2 Arts Council Seeks Anishinaabe Arts Initiative Council Members

Region 2 Arts Council is currently seeking AAI Council members to fill vacancies beginning November 1, 2009.
